Servelec Technologies, the leading provider of business optimisation solutions in the UK water industry, has successfully delivered a number of trials of its pioneering FlowSure software to UK water companies. Trials will be described that have demonstrated that annual six figure net savings can be realised by use of the software. More than a simple leakage detection system, FlowSure is self-learning anomaly detection software that helps to identify and predict emerging network events to enable companies to prevent rather than respond to major events. Avoiding network leakage serves to reduce costs of contact handling and regulatory penalties as well as leading to improved customer service levels. The software uses an Artificial Neural Network to analyse data of scalable size and complexity in a simple user flexible tool that provides geospatial visualisation of events and alarms. It can be combined with other tools such as Asset Management and Network control as an integrated solution to provide a holistic approach to optimisation of the water system thus avoiding or mitigating the effects of leakage, bursts and blockages.
